This intriguing exhibition showcases a selection of art from our collection that engages with Jewish religious thought and practice, and art influenced by Jewish historical events. Discover depictions of kings, fantastical creatures, young girls and survivors of war, as artists including Felix Tuszynski, David Rankin, Yosl Bergner, Victor Majzner and Simcha Fetter wrestle with themes of trauma, survival, Jewish mysticism and biblical heroes.
